Transaction 88669bc1852ba1209bb4474279f2bb8553483357d3c8fceb4c4fde5bf2d372ff

1 Input
2 Outputs
  • 88669bc1852ba1209bb4474279f2bb8553483357d3c8fceb4c4fde5bf2d372ff:0
  • value  58315112
    address  32wmm6hYJFeSuAWBLsLH9PH3yx7WrW6keh
  • 88669bc1852ba1209bb4474279f2bb8553483357d3c8fceb4c4fde5bf2d372ff:1
  • value  621688
    address  3DKy9shP8LXUkHfJMuMMNXFbo7SjvxHaX6